3 The Graph (GRT)

The Graph provides essential indexing and querying services for blockchain data, often termed the 'Google of Web3.' As dApp development proliferates towards 2026, the demand for efficient data access will only intensify. GRT's network effects, with increasing subgraphs and decentralized indexers, could drive its value. Risks include potential competitors offering similar services or changes in blockchain architecture reducing the need for external indexing. Its fundamental role in data accessibility is a strong point.

6 Render Network (RNDR)

RNDR provides decentralized GPU rendering services, a crucial component for the expanding metaverse, AI, and digital content creation industries. By February 2026, the demand for scalable and cost-effective rendering power is projected to grow significantly. RNDR’s model of connecting idle GPU resources to creators offers a compelling solution. Competition from centralized cloud providers and the pace of Web3 content adoption are key risk factors. Its utility in a growing digital economy is a strong bullish case.

What are the primary risks of investing in low-cap Web3 coins?

Low-cap Web3 coins carry substantial risks, including extreme price volatility, lower liquidity making trades difficult, potential for project failure, regulatory uncertainty, and vulnerability to market manipulation. Thorough due diligence and a clear understanding of the project's technology and team are crucial.

How can I identify promising low-cap Web3 projects?

Look for projects with clear utility, active development, strong community engagement, transparent roadmaps, and solutions addressing a real need within the Web3 ecosystem. Evaluate the team's experience, tokenomics, and potential for adoption. Avoid projects based solely on hype or vague promises.
